Abstract

The present disclosure provides a photographic exposure method for a self-moving device. The method includes: detecting, based on a preset rule, brightness information of a target region in an image; adjusting a exposure parameter in response to the detected brightness information not meeting a preset condition; and performing, based on the adjusted exposure parameter, exposure in a localized region during image acquisition, the localized region including at least the target region.

Claims (40)

1 . A photographic exposure method for a self-moving device, comprising:

detecting, based on a preset rule, brightness information of a target region in an image, wherein detecting the brightness information of the target region comprises dividing the target region into sub-regions, obtaining brightness values of the respective sub-regions, and obtaining the brightness information by weight-averaging the brightness values of the respective sub-regions with corresponding weight values of the respective sub-regions, and wherein the target region comprises a reflective surface region and a space region, the space region is located in a middle of the target region, and the reflective surface region is located on left and right sides of the space region and/or below the space region;

adjusting an exposure parameter in response to the detected brightness information not meeting a preset condition; and

performing, based on the adjusted exposure parameter, exposure in a localized region during image acquisition, the localized region comprising at least the target region.

2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ein adjusting the exposure parameter in response to the detected brightness information not meeting the preset condition, comprises:

comparing the brightness information with target brightness;

increasing the exposure parameter in response to the brightness information being less than the target brightness; and

decreasing the exposure parameter in response to the brightness information being greater than the target brightness.

3 . The method of claim 1 , wherein dividing the target region into the sub-regions and obtaining the brightness values of the respective sub-regions, comprises:

dividing the target region into the sub-regions, dividing each sub-region of the sub-regions into a plurality of image blocks, and obtaining average brightness values of the respective image blocks, respectively; and

obtaining the brightness values of the respective sub-regions by weight-averaging the average brightness values of the respective image blocks with corresponding weight values of the respective image blocks.

4 . The method of claim 1 , wherein a weight value of the space region is greater than a weight value of the reflective surface region.

5 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the exposure parameter comprises at least one of: exposure time and an exposure gain.
